Do not force loading all kt-files inside LazyPackageDescriptor constructor

Effectively it leads to all stubs being built for any once used package

The idea is that they only were used for FILE_TO_PACKAGE_FRAGMENT
that is mostly read in backend and rarely in the IDE, so we can replace
its usages with searching through related package-fragments
